Csharp Pro
A C# expert skill for modern .NET development - records, SOLID design, async/await, comprehensive testing, and enterprise architecture patterns. Use it for C#/.NET development tasks needing modern language features and enterprise patterns, not for unrelated domains or tools.
What it does
This is a C# expert skill for modern .NET development and enterprise-grade applications, focused on modern C# features (records, pattern matching, nullable reference types), the .NET ecosystem (ASP.NET Core, Entity Framework, Blazor), SOLID principles and design patterns, performance optimization and memory management, async/await and concurrent programming with the Task Parallel Library, comprehensive testing (xUnit, NUnit, Moq, FluentAssertions), and enterprise/microservices architecture. Its approach favors composition over inheritance, nullable reference types with comprehensive error handling, performance work using Span/Memory/value types, and non-blocking async patterns throughout.
